WebThe Whale Caller by Zakes Mda. As Zakes Mda’s fifth novel opens, the seaside village of Hermanus is overrun with whale-watchers–foreign tourists determined to see whales in their natural habitat. But when the tourists have gone home, the whale caller lingers at the shoreline, wooing a whale he has named Sharisha with cries from a kelp horn. ... WebJan 10, 2006 · The Whale Caller prefers not to be a public figure. His relationship to whales, and to one whale in particular, is both mystical and romantic. WebA kelp-horn-blowing man seems to be deeply drawn to a very particular whale. This is the story of a love triangle between the titular Whale Caller, his beloved whale Sharisha, and Saluni, the village drunk who teaches him to open his heart to people again.
